Overview of the job
The MAPPA Coordinator supports, and is accountable to, the local MAPPA Strategic Management Board (SMB) to provide management of MAPPA activity.
MAPPA Co-ordination aims to ensure that multi-agency risk management is focussed on the right people in a timely and efficient manner. It helps ensure the delivery of robust and defensible plans, which address known indicators of serious harm to others.
This is a management role undertaken on behalf of the local SMB within a multi- disciplinary team. The jobholder, will be subject to their agencies policies, aims and values.

SUMMARY

In line with national MAPPA guidance, the MAPPA coordinator is the single point of contact for MAPPA and has overall responsibility for the oversight of MAPPA arrangements.

    MAPPA is a critical part of public protection work. The successful candidate will be passionate about the role of public protection and risk management to reduce re-offending and protect victims. The role of MAPPA Coordinator ensures that the local MAPPA arrangements run efficiently. It is a diverse role w you will be expected to provide leadership and direction in work with partners and key stakeholders on behalf of the Strategic Management Board to manage MAPPA registered individuals. The role will require you to develop and deliver training/briefing sessions for MAPPA to staff within the relevant Responsible Authorities and Duty to Cooperate Agencies as well as managing small projects to support other agencies within the MAPPA forum. The MAPPA Coordinator acts as point of contact across the SMB area holding overall responsibility and oversight, this includes acting as Central Point of Contact on ViSOR. The role involves line management of MAPPA/ViSOR administrative staff along with recruitment and management of Lay Advisors, ensuring all team resources are deployed cost effectively whilst overseeing the joint MAPPA budget. The post holder will play an important role in the wider KSS Public Protection Leadership Team

Responsibilities

The job holder will be required to carry out the following responsibilities, activities and duties:

  • To be accountable to the SMB
  • To be the single point of contact for the management of MAPPA offenders
  • To work on behalf of the SMB to implement the MAPPA process as outlined in the MAPPA guidance
  • To ensure effective and appropriate information sharing
  • To ensure that statistical data is collated and reported upon as required in the MAPPA guidance
  • To work on behalf of the SMB to implement the SMB Business Plan
  • To provide necessary training and quality assurance for the management of MAPPA offenders
  • To be the ViSOR central point of contact for the MAPPA area
  • To provide effective management and leadership to the team
  • To be accountable for the quality delivery of good practice and team performance improvement within policy
  • To ensure that all team resources, are deployed cost effectively and provide best value in terms of both budget control and realising the MAPPA’s strategic aims
  • To access, interpret, analyse and apply performance data pro-actively in order to maximise MAPPA performance, evaluate practice and deliver MAPPA aims
  • To proactively manage staff development, issues of underperformance, attendance, health and safety, employee relations and diversity matters. Adopt a consistent, fair and objective standpoint when making decisions in relation to individual staff issues
  • To promote a culture of innovation and continuous improvement to MAPPA

service delivery

  • In accordance with the SMB business plan, to provide a leading role and direction in work with partners and key stakeholders, and represent the NPS as appropriate to the role
  • To facilitate effective communication between the Responsible Authorities and the Duty to Cooperate Agencies and to ensure they are provided with up to date information.
  • To develop and deliver training/briefing sessions for MAPPA to staff within the relevant Responsible Authorities and Duty to Cooperate Agencies.
  • Ensure that local MAPPA arrangements comply with statutory safeguarding responsibilities.
